11. Wall picture. "Holiday" Nóra Tápay, 1990 Cotton, wool, silk and metal thread, mixed technique. 108 x 96 cm The picture is composed of black silk and green wool, applied on black cotton warps tied to a wooden frame. From the exhibition organised on die occasion of the centenary of the births of Boni and Noómi Ferenczy. Vigadó Galéria, 1991. Taken over from the Ministry of Culture. Inv.No. 91.45.1 12. Tapestry. "Letter fragment" Éva Pintér," 1990 Tapestry woven from wool. 76 x 93 cm A grey stripe in a brown frame. The surface shows a bunch of lillies-of-the-valley, against an ochre base, with the inscription "lily of the valley yours sincerely Pintér Éva" above. From die exhibition organised on the occasion of die centenary of die births of Béni and Noémi Ferenczy. Vigadó Galéria, 1991. Taken over from the Ministry of Culture. Inv. No. 91.46.1 13. Tapestry. "1989" Éva Pcnkaia, 1989-90 Tapestry woven from wool. 220 x 220 cm Against a dark blue background, there are red flames bursting out from leaves like a volcano, stretching towards a purple, greenish sky. From die exhibition organised on the occasion of die centenary of die births of Béni and Noémi Ferenczy. Vigadó Galéria, 1991. Taken over from the Ministry of Culture. Inv.No. 91.48.1 14. Tapestry. "Together" Klára Cságoly, 1973 Tapestry woven from natural coloured wool. 165 x 234 cm The plain woven base is decorated with a relief pattern of overloopcd weaving technique. The whole surface is filled with two confronting semicircles, ending in tips at the top and bottom. Donated by die IDEA Company. Inv.No. 91.80.1 15. Tapestry. "The Wing of An Angel" Gizi Solti Tapestry woven from wool. 99 x 142 cm. A beige and purple shaded, stylised angel, shaped like a horizontal drop, with a small, green spaceship entangled in her wing on the right. Donated by die IDEA Company. Inv.No. 91.81.1 16. Tapestry. "Confined together" Erzsébet Kozó Woven of white, pink and light beige wool and sisal. 110 x 110 cm The square surface is divided into four fields by the medial lines; the fields arc filled with squares, rectangles and L-shaped motifs of different colours and different weaving techniques. Purchased from Erzsébet Kozó. Inv.No. 91.157.1 (Emese Pásztor)
